Bonito sits in a karst landscape in Brazil, and its dive sites are entirely freshwater: flooded cave systems, rivers, and a reservoir. Visibility is the defining feature, reaching between thirty and fifty metres in the clearest river sites during the dry season from May to September, though the reservoir at Lago do Manso runs significantly lower. Water temperatures vary by site, with the cave at Abismo Anhumas sitting as cold as seventeen degrees Celsius while shallower river sites are somewhat warmer. Access to sites is controlled through a regulated voucher system, and the depth range across the region is wide, from shallow snorkelling rivers to technical cave dives beyond thirty metres at Gruta Mimoso.
